Output 7e66b1871fd4d6686cecf66814f9bef21cd4c6dd13602778f95b85cd2d67da95:6

value
308048254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f71faebbeebf9fd4725439dce3e1cdc4a55e8a0 OP_EQUAL
address
MNSEDQpjbZp5B41bhfL3id6xdy3ev4Ddqb
transaction
7e66b1871fd4d6686cecf66814f9bef21cd4c6dd13602778f95b85cd2d67da95
spent
true